There are 2 colors u can get the NZXT Lexa Blackline in, blue or red leds. Im not a big fan of the red and therefore want the blue leds but unfortunatly i cant find any retailers that sell the blue led version in the US. If anyone knows where i can get one or if i can just change the red led fans with blue led fans and it will have the same effect, it would be greatly appreciated.
Antec sells 120mm blue led fans separately as well as other brands that should go right in that brand case there unless you locate a vendor that carries one with the blue color included.
